People moved westward in different times of American history for many reasons. At first, in the early 1800s, settlers went west for new land and better farming opportunities. Then, during the Gold Rush in the 1840s, lots of people rushed west looking for gold and hoping to get rich. Later, after the Civil War, more people moved west to build new towns and railroads. Each time, they were looking for adventure and a chance to start fresh!
